1. You've installed Langflow using _`pip install langflow`_ but you already had a previous version of Langflow installed in your system.
In this case, you might be running the wrong executable.
To solve this issue, run the correct executable by running _`python -m langflow run`_ instead of _`langflow run`_.
If that doesn't work, try uninstalling and reinstalling Langflow with _`python -m pip install langflow --pre -U`_.
2. Some version conflicts might have occurred during the installation process.
Run _`python -m pip install langflow --pre -U --force-reinstall`_ to reinstall Langflow and its dependencies.

### Details
This error can occur during Langflow upgrades when the new version can't override `langflow-pre.db` in `.cache/langflow/`. Clearing the cache removes this file but will also erase your settings.
